At a Glance
- Tasks: Design and develop large-scale backend architectures for real-time data processing.
- Company: Join an innovative tech team in London focused on IoT and AI.
- Benefits: Competitive salary, flexible working hours, and opportunities for professional growth.
- Other info: Dynamic environment with a focus on collaboration and innovation.
- Why this job: Work with cutting-edge technologies and make a real impact in the IoT and AI space.
- Qualifications: Experience in Python, distributed systems, and strong communication skills.
The predicted salary is between 60000 - 80000 β¬ per year.
IC Resources is seeking an experienced Backend Engineer to join their innovative technology team in London. This role involves designing and developing large-scale backend architectures that process real-time data.
Key technologies include:
- Python (FastAPI)
- Postgres
- AWS
The ideal candidate will have a background in distributed systems and experience optimizing performance in large-scale environments. Strong communication skills and the ability to work in cross-functional teams are essential, as well as an interest in cutting-edge technologies integrating ML and AI.
Senior Python Backend Engineer β Real-Time IoT & AI in London employer: IC Resources
IC Resources is an exceptional employer that fosters a dynamic and collaborative work culture in the heart of London, where innovation thrives. Employees benefit from continuous professional development opportunities, working alongside industry experts on cutting-edge technologies in IoT and AI. With a focus on employee well-being and a commitment to diversity, IC Resources offers a rewarding environment for those looking to make a meaningful impact in technology.
StudySmarter Expert Adviceπ€«
We think this is how you could land Senior Python Backend Engineer β Real-Time IoT & AI in London
β¨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ect with people on LinkedIn. You never know who might have the inside scoop on job openings or can refer you directly.
β¨Tip Number 2
Show off your skills! Create a portfolio showcasing your projects, especially those involving Python, FastAPI, and AWS. This will give potential employers a taste of what you can do and set you apart from the crowd.
β¨Tip Number 3
Prepare for technical interviews by brushing up on your knowledge of distributed systems and performance optimisation. Practice coding challenges and be ready to discuss your thought process during problem-solving.
β¨Tip Number 4
Donβt forget to apply through our website! Weβve got some fantastic opportunities waiting for you, and applying directly can sometimes give you an edge. Plus, itβs super easy to keep track of your applications!
We think you need these skills to ace Senior Python Backend Engineer β Real-Time IoT & AI in London
Some tips for your application π«‘
Show Off Your Python Skills:Make sure to highlight your experience with Python, especially with FastAPI. We want to see how you've tackled backend challenges in the past, so share specific projects or examples that showcase your expertise.
Talk About Real-Time Data:Since this role involves processing real-time data, donβt forget to mention any relevant experience you have. Whether itβs working with distributed systems or optimising performance, weβre keen to hear how youβve handled similar challenges.
Communicate Clearly:Strong communication skills are a must for us. When writing your application, be clear and concise. We appreciate candidates who can articulate their thoughts well, especially when it comes to working in cross-functional teams.
Apply Through Our Website:We encourage you to apply directly through our website. Itβs the best way for us to receive your application and ensures you donβt miss out on any important updates during the process!
How to prepare for a job interview at IC Resources
β¨Know Your Tech Stack
Make sure youβre well-versed in Python, FastAPI, Postgres, and AWS. Brush up on your knowledge of these technologies and be ready to discuss how you've used them in past projects. Being able to talk about specific challenges you faced and how you overcame them will impress the interviewers.
β¨Showcase Your Distributed Systems Experience
Since the role involves working with large-scale backend architectures, prepare examples from your previous work that highlight your experience with distributed systems. Discuss any performance optimisation techniques you've implemented and how they improved system efficiency.
β¨Communicate Clearly
Strong communication skills are a must for this position. Practice explaining complex technical concepts in simple terms, as youβll likely need to collaborate with cross-functional teams. Think about how you can convey your ideas clearly and concisely during the interview.
β¨Stay Curious About AI and ML
Given the focus on integrating cutting-edge technologies like AI and ML, show your enthusiasm for these areas. Be prepared to discuss any relevant projects or research you've done, and express your interest in how these technologies can enhance backend systems.